14. PUFA Assessment - Fatty Acid Test
The PUFA test analysis 28 Fatty acids and as a result provides the Omega-3 Index (with individual DHA & EPA results); Inflammatory Markers; the Fatty Acid Balance Indicator; an early Indicator of Type ll Diabetes as well as comprehensive overview of a patients dietary intake.The analysis performed on red blood cells provides a comprehensive overview of a patients nutritional status of the last ~3 months (average lifespan of a red blood cell), this permits nutritional changes to be monitored with repeat testing every 3-6 months to assess benefits of interventions and/or dietary modifications.

Comprehensive
Cancer Screen ( i-Finder)
Cancer thrives because of the enviroment in our bodies. Existing cancer detection methods focus on finding evidence of tumors in the blood, but this is only possible with a tumor of a significant size. Therefore, to more accurately detect cancer earlier, i-FINDER looks for the right enviromental factors in combination with evidence of cancer.
i-FINDER is a cutting edge cancer screening developed in collaboration with Seoul National University Cancer Research Institute TIMRC. The test assesses 19 biomarkers and also evaluates new blood vessel proliferation, overall immune system health and metabolism flow to determine cancer risk.
